How Our Laundry Room Water Removal Service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your Laundry Room Water Removal is done correctly and efficiently. We start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and developing a customized plan to restore your property. Our technicians are IICRC-certified and equipped with the latest technology to extract water, dry the area, and prevent mold growth. You can trust us to get the job done right the first time.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ive at your property, assess the damage, and identify the source of the leak. Our team will develop a customized plan to restore your property, taking into account the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Chesterfield, MI. Our goal is to reduce disruption to your daily routine and get you back to normal life as quickly as possible.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use advanced equipment to extract standing water from your laundry room, including w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and extractors. We’ll work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including dehumidifiers and fans. Our team will monitor the area to ensure it’s completely dry, preventing further damage and mold growth. This step is crucial to preventing secondary damage and ensuring your property is restored to its original condition.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will clean and sanitize the affected area, removing any remaining water, dirt, and debris.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your property is restored to a safe and healthy environment.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Once the area is dry and clean, our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ct your laundry room to its original condition. This may include replacing drywall, flooring, and fixtures, as well as repainting and refinishing surfaces.

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| DIY can handle small leaks,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age. |
| Large water leak (more than 1 gallon) | No | Yes | A large water leak needs professional equ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your safety. |
| Standing water (more than 2 inches) | No | Yes | Stand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to extract and dry the area safely and efficiently. |
| Visible water damage (warped or buckled flooring) | No | Yes | Visible water damage needs profess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age and ensure your safety. |
| Unpleasant odors in the laundry room | No | Yes | Unpleasant odors in the laundry room can show mold and mildew, which needs professional assessment and remediation. |
| Water damage caused by a burst pipe | No | Yes | A burst pipe needs professional equipment and expertise to repair and prevent further damage. |

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Chesterfield, MI
The cost of Laundry Room Water Removal in Chesterfield, MI can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more. The cost will depend on the extent of the damage, the materials needed to repair or replace, and the labor required to complete the job. Our team will provide a free estimate to help you understand the costs involved and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ed |
| Documentation and insurance claims |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, type of insurance coverage |
